Overview

Are you passionate about delivering high-quality, person-centred care? Do you thrive in a fast-paced service where your leadership directly improves patient experience and supports staff to grow, feel valued and work as a unified team?

If so, our Urgent Community Response (UCR) service would love to hear from you.

We are seeking a motivated, confident and compassionate Social Care Team Lead to join our integrated multi‑professional team. This role is central to ensuring safe, timely, and effective care for people in crisis at home across East Sussex — helping prevent avoidable hospital admissions and supporting people to remain where they feel most comfortable.


Responsibilities

* Provide daily operational support to Team Leads and shift coordinators
* Oversee effective rostering and workforce deployment
* Lead and mentor staff through supervision, live observation and feedback
* Support training, education and competency assessment frameworks
* Drive continuous improvement, service development and project work
* Support complex case management and inter-professional working
* Ensure safe, high-quality care aligned with Trust policy and safeguarding standards
* Foster a positive, inclusive and collaborative team culture


About You

You’ll be an experienced and motivated leader with a strong grounding in adult health or social care, bringing both confidence and compassion to your work.


You Will Have

* A good general level of education, including English and Maths, and be educated to degree level in a relevant field or have equivalent knowledge and experience gained in practice.
* Leadership training or qualifications at Level 4 or Level 5.


You Will Bring

* At least 3 years’ experience working with adults in health or social care
* Experience supervising or managing staff, including performance management
* Strong communication skills and confidence in supporting complex situations
* Ability to lead calmly under pressure and navigate challenging conversations
* Commitment to high-quality care, learning culture, and continuous improvement
* A values‑driven approach: kindness, inclusivity, integrity.

Statement on the Use of AI

We value the individuality that each candidate brings to the application process. While we understand that AI tools are widely available, we strongly discourage applicants from using AI-generated content when applying for jobs with us. We believe that your application should reflect your true skills, experiences, and motivations, which are best conveyed through your own words and unique perspective.

Using AI for your application may not accurately represent your knowledge, skills, and experience and may result in a disconnect between your qualifications and our assessment of your application.

We encourage applicants to take the time to thoughtfully complete their applications; by doing so, you allow us to better understand your true potential and ensure a fair and transparent evaluation of your application. Over reliance on AI-generated content may diminish your chance of success.
